Output 6c50168646b06838075265926945f59da297d57330c7ccb47f04d2c2bb8076a2:0

value
17500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d729263625053366a09cd23ab30df21cae02567 OP_EQUAL
address
MGRGKrsVQQvpTx7PGtgdJD4knqn5bmX5D1
transaction
6c50168646b06838075265926945f59da297d57330c7ccb47f04d2c2bb8076a2
spent
true